Output 85e6bcaaa6c6c296d778082a0bf077d5889e490ca50a0da6e062c488e73c38db:1

value
27401156556
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95fff2d3e9ed86f9f945c8aeb8e4fc013528678 OP_EQUALVERIFY OP_CHECKSIG
address
1NGySfrpRi54DBZehLrYh582adjFQ29Ggg
transaction
85e6bcaaa6c6c296d778082a0bf077d5889e490ca50a0da6e062c488e73c38db
confirmations
723750
spent
true